![]() ![]() Language-oriented roles like these are susceptible to automation, Madgavkar said. Like media roles, jobs in the legal industry such as paralegals and legal assistants are responsible for consuming large amounts of information, synthesizing what they learned, then making it digestible through a legal brief or opinion. That's because the number of jobs in legal services is relatively small and have already been highly exposed to AI automation before the advent of new AI tools, Manav Raj, an author of the Goldman study, told Insider. ![]() Generative AI may most likely affect legal workers in the US, a recent Goldman Sachs report found. "There's a ton of human judgment that goes into each of these occupations," she said.ĪI can replicate some of the work that paralegals and legal assistants do, though they aren't entirely replaceable, experts say. Tech news site CNET used an AI tool similar to ChatGPT to write dozens of articles - though the publisher has had to issue a number of corrections - and BuzzFeed has used tech from the ChatGPT maker to generate new forms of content like quizzes and travel guides.īut Madgavkar said that the majority of work done by content creators is not automatable. The media industry is already beginning to experiment with AI-generated content. ![]() "Analyzing and interpreting vast amounts of language based data and information is a skill that you'd expect generative AI technologies to ramp up on," Madgavkar said.Įconomist Paul Krugman said in a New York Times op-ed that ChatGPT may be able to do tasks like reporting and writing "more efficiently than humans." That's because AI is able to read, write, and understand text-based data well, she added. Media jobs across the board - including those in advertising, technical writing, journalism, and any role that involves content creation - may be affected by ChatGPT and similar forms of AI, Madgavkar said. It actually can write code quite well."Įxperts say AI like ChatGPT is good at producing written content and can do so "more efficiently than humans." ![]() "Coding and programming is a good example of that. "In terms of jobs, I think it's primarily an enhancer than full replacement of jobs," Netzer told CBS MoneyWatch. Still, Oded Netzer, a Columbia Business School professor, thinks that AI will help coders rather than replace them. Tech companies like ChatGPT maker's OpenAI are already considering replacing software engineers with AI. "What took a team of software developers might only take some of them," he added. In fact, advanced technologies like ChatGPT could produce code faster than humans, which means that work can be completed with fewer employees, Mark Muro, a senior fellow at the Brookings Institute who has researched AI's impact on the American workforce, told Insider. That's because AI like ChatGPT is good at crunching numbers with relative accuracy. Tech jobs such as software developers, web developers, computer programmers, coders, and data scientists are "pretty amenable" to AI technologies "displacing more of their work," Madgavkar said. The ABA routing number is a 9-digit identification number assigned to financial institutions by The American Bankers Association (ABA). Top 15 Credit Unions Alaska Usa Credit UnionĪBA Routing Number: Routing numbers are also referred to as "Check Routing Numbers", "ABA Numbers", or "Routing Transit Numbers" (RTN). ![]() Routing number of a bank usually differ only by state and is generally same for all branches in a state. **Address mentioned in the table may differ from your branch office address.
